## Architecture Decisions
Humans write these. Agents read and enforce them.
| ID | Decision | Rationale |
|---|---|---|
| AD-001 | Nervous system runs from cron, not action issues. | Planner, predictor, gardener, supervisor run directly via `*-run.sh`. They create work, they don't become work. (See PR #474 revert.) |
| AD-002 | Single-threaded pipeline per project. | One dev issue at a time. No new work while a PR awaits CI or review. Prevents merge conflicts and keeps context clear. |
| AD-003 | The runtime creates and destroys, the formula preserves. | Runtime manages worktrees/sessions/temp. Formulas commit knowledge to git before signaling done. |
| AD-004 | Event-driven > polling > fixed delays. | Never `waitForTimeout` or hardcoded sleep. Use phase files, webhooks, or poll loops with backoff. |
| AD-005 | Secrets via env var indirection, never in issue bodies. | Issue bodies become code. Secrets go in `.env` or TOML project files, referenced as `$VAR_NAME`. |
**Who enforces what:**
- **Gardener** checks open backlog issues against ADs during grooming; closes violations with a comment referencing the AD number.
- **Planner** plans within the architecture; does not create issues that violate ADs.
- **Dev-agent** reads AGENTS.md before implementing; refuses work that violates ADs.

7. Architecture decision alignment check (AD check):
For each open issue labeled 'backlog', check whether the issue
contradicts any architecture decision listed in the
## Architecture Decisions section of AGENTS.md.
Read AGENTS.md and extract the AD table. For each backlog issue,
compare the issue title and body against each AD. If an issue
clearly violates an AD:
a. Post a comment explaining the violation:
curl -sf -X POST -H "Authorization: token $CODEBERG_TOKEN" \
-H "Content-Type: application/json" \
"$CODEBERG_API/issues/<number>/comments" \
-d '{"body":"Closing: violates AD-NNN (<decision summary>). See AGENTS.md § Architecture Decisions."}'
b. Close the issue:
curl -sf -X PATCH -H "Authorization: token $CODEBERG_TOKEN" \
-H "Content-Type: application/json" \
"$CODEBERG_API/issues/<number>" \
-d '{"state":"closed"}'
c. Log to the result file:
echo "ACTION: closed #NNN — violates AD-NNN" >> "$RESULT_FILE"
Only close for clear, unambiguous violations. If the issue is
borderline or could be interpreted as compatible, leave it open
and ESCALATE instead.
